Pro Photo 4: Skyfall

I’ve never been a huge bond movie fan. I was always one to love the Sean Connery bonds myself, but that was before I saw Skyfall, which led me to purchase the other Daniel Craig bond movies. Skyfall was definitely my favorite, but there was one thing that stood out to me. The Skyfall statue was a huge significance to the film which had gotten stuck in my mind. Originally I was going to work on a poster design featuring the statue which I turned into a logo. That’s where the inspiration for Skyfall came into play. I wanted the design to be classy much like you would expect bond would be. So I used black and golds and minimalistic features to get that aesthetic across.

Images courtesy of and provided by Red Leaf Boutique.

Skyfall includes all the photoshop files necessary to make it your own, but this design is actually the first one I’ve included header slideshow templates that are different than the rest. I changed out the layouts and got rid of the spacing between images, and added a welcome message to give the design some individuality. Photoshop files are compatible with older versions of Photoshop CS and Elements.
